No. 10 Buckeyes Fall to No. 20 Wolverines in B1G Tournament Final
5/1/2022 5:34:00 PM | Women's Tennis
COLUMBUS, Ohio – The No. 10 Ohio State women's tennis team fell to No. 20 Michigan, 4-0, Sunday afternoon in the championship match of the Big Ten Tournament in Iowa City, Iowa. The Buckeyes dropped the doubles point and lost three matches in straight sets in the final vs. the Wolverines.
The Buckeyes, the tournament's No. 1 seed, are now 20-5 on the year, with the No. 2 seed Wolverines 19-5. Ohio State, which had an 11-match losing streak end, was making the sixth appearance in the tournament final in program history and has won three tourney titles.
Irina Cantos Siemers and Sydni Ratliff were named to the Big Ten All-Tournament Team.

In Doubles
- Michigan opened the match with a 1-0 lead after taking the doubles point.
- On court one, the Buckeye tandem of Isabelle Boulais and Kolie Allen fell 6-3 to Julia Fliegner and Jaedan Brown, with the Wolverines winning the final four games.
- The Buckeye duo of Sydni Ratliff and Luna Dormet tied doubles, as they won 6-4 on court three against Anca Craciun and Nicole Hammond. Ratliff and Dormet were down a break early but got back on serve at four-all and then won the final two games, both on the deciding point.
- The doubles point came down to court two. Buckeyes Irina Cantos Siemers and Lucia Marzal were down 5-2 against Andrea Cerdan and Kari Miller before winning back-to-back games for a 5-4 match, but the Wolverines held to clinch the match.
In Singles
- The teams split the first sets, with Ohio State winning on courts three, four and six. The Wolverines were able to close out their three courts in straight sets for the victory, with wins on courts one, two and five.
- Fliegner posted a 6-3, 6-0 win over Marzal on court five to put the Wolverines up 2-0.
- In a matchup of Top 20 players on court one, Michigan's No. 19-ranked Miller won 6-2, 6-2, over No. 8 Cantos Siemers.
- The championship point was clinched on court two. Michigan's No. 92 Jaedan Brown won the first set vs. No. 37 Boulais, 6-3. In the second, Boulais won the final two games to force a tiebreaker, but Brown prevailed, 7-3, with the last four points.
- The other three matches were suspended, with one in a third set, one about to start a third and one still in the second.
- Buckeye Ratliff, ranked 72nd, won the first set vs. Hammond 6-3, with the final three games, but lost the second in a tiebreak. A game had not yet been completed in the third set.
- Allen used an early break on court four against Cerdan to win the first set, 6-4, and the Wolverine won by the same score in the second, taking the final four games. They were tied at a game each in the third.
- On court six, Dormet won the first set, 6-4, against Gala Mesochoritou. They were on serve with Dormet serving 5-6 in the second when play was suspended.
